The Hungerbach is a right tributary of the Altmühl near Treuchtlingen in the Weißenburg-Gunzenhausen district in Central Franconia .
course
The Hungerbach rises at an altitude of 460 m above sea level. NN in the area of the municipality Langenaltheim between Höfen in the southwest, Altheimersberg in the northeast and Rutzenhof in the northwest. Initially it flows steadily in a northerly direction parallel to federal highway 2 . South of Dietfurt in Middle Franconia, the river turns to the southeast. The Hungerbach empties at an altitude of 407 m above sea level. NN southwest of Dietfurt from the right into the Altmühl.
